Candace Clinch David, 76, of South Buffalo Twp., passed away on Wednesday, November 30, 2022 at her home with her family by her side. Candy was born in Mount Vernon, NY on November 11, 1946, a daughter of the late Virginia Katherine (Danford) and Allan Manning Clinch. She was the widow of Raymond D. "Slugger" David who passed in 2019. Candace had an incredible work ethic with a passion for the law, entrepreneurship, and real estate. She was a Legal Secretary for over 40 years assisting several prestigious law firms in Akron, Ohio, Elyria Ohio and New Kensington Pennsylvania. Owned and operated several businesses: Candy’s Ice Cream Parlor (Elyria OH) and Sisters Three and Me (Freeport PA) and was a Real Estate agent for Apro Reality (Leechburg PA). Candace enjoyed gardening, traveling, playing golf, spending time with her family, a puzzle enthusiast, beating everyone in Scrabble and advocating for several local animal rescues. While her family and friends will miss her incredibly, we celebrate that she will once again be reunited with the love of her life Raymond. Candy is survived by her daughter, Kelly Ann Dunn, and her fiancé Jeff Huber, of Troutman, NC and her son, Scott Thomas Dunn & Jeanie Faiola, of Akron, OH. Sisters Vicki Kepnes and Denise Kendel-Stewart & Neal Stewart, brother-in-law Thomas Brown and many nephews and nieces throughout Ohio, Pennsylvania, Maryland and Nevada. She was preceded in death by her parents, husband, Raymond Dale David. Her sister, Penelope Clinch Brown. Brother, Frank Allan Clinch, Brother-In-Law, Charles Kepnes and Great niece, Melissa Kepnes.
